I spoke with Professor Richard Susskind CBE KC (Hon), President of the Society for Computers and Law and author of many notable books, including his most recent publication, How to Think About AI - A Guide for the Perplexed. We discussed strategies for balancing the benefits and risks of artificial intelligence, how technology can help legal professionals better serve their clients, and ways that leaders in the legal field should approach AI to drive their organizations forward.
